"Noreen?"

She looked up to see who had called her.

It was Healy.

Another of Seth's childhood friends.

Of course, back in the day, Healy had never been warm to her either.

But unlike Jude, who could fly off the handle at a moment's notice like a rabid dog, Healy's cruelty was quieter—sharper, somehow.

Like now. Even though he hadn't said a word yet, the mocking smirk on his face made his opinion perfectly clear.

No doubt he was inwardly sneering, wondering if she was still hopelessly trailing after Seth like a stray.

There was a time when Noreen would have pretended not to notice, maybe even gone out of her way to strike up a conversation, desperately trying to break into their group.

She'd tried for seven years. Seven years spent banging on a door that was never going to open.

Back then, she thought she just wasn't trying hard enough.

Now she understood. It was never about effort. They'd simply never wanted her. She'd always been on the outside looking in.

Different worlds, she thought. No point forcing your way in.

Noreen pulled her gaze away, cold and indifferent. She didn't greet him. Didn't acknowledge him at all. Just acted as if he wasn't there.

That reaction caught Healy off guard.

He gave a quiet, sarcastic laugh, then came over and sat down across from her. "News travels fast with you, huh? Heard Seth was coming and rushed over?"

Noreen had no idea Seth would be here.

But Healy's insinuation irritated her.

She shot back, "I'm impressed. How do you come up with this stuff and still live to tell about it?"

Healy was momentarily taken aback.

After all, the Noreen he remembered was always gentle, accommodating, a pushover. They used to mock her right to her face and she never once got angry, never even blushed.

Even when they met again, she'd always been unfailingly polite.

But now? That sharp retort had caught him totally off guard.

Still, Healy didn't get mad. He just smirked, "Do I need to make things up? Wasn't this your thing? Used to act like you wished you could glue yourself to Seth. Now you're denying it?"
